About this House

This furnished home features a spacious carport and plenty of storage throughout. The kitchen offers abundant cabinetry, black appliances, and an electric range for convenient meal preparation. The bathroom includes a tub/shower combination. A mini-split system in the living room provides efficient comfort year-round. Outside, you'll find a storage shed for tools and extra belongings.Located in the desirable community of The Reserve at Lost Dutchman in Apache Junction, AZ, this home provides a peaceful and welcoming environment. The Reserve at Lost Dutchman is known for its friendly atmosphere and well-maintained surroundings, offering residents a great place to enjoy the beautiful desert landscape. With easy access to local amenities, recreational opportunities, and stunning views of the nearby mountains, this community is ideal for those seeking a relaxed lifestyle in a scenic setting.
